BookTrust is the UK’s largest children’s reading charity. We are dedicated to getting children reading. Each year we reach millions of children across the UK with books, resources and support to help develop a love of reading.

We get children reading in lots of different ways, but our priority is to get more children excited about books, rhymes and stories – because if reading is fun, children will want to do it. We run nationwide programmes – like our flagship programme Bookstart. We reach millions of families across the country each year with books, resources and advice to encourage parents and carers to start reading with their babies right from the beginning.

Much of our focus is on early years because we’ve learnt that starting early and involving the whole family is the best way to get children reading. We also work with schools to support teachers and school librarians to get children and young people excited about books and reading.

We want all families to have access to reading, which is why we also deliver more targeted programmes aimed at helping those who need us most – whether that’s families facing economic hardship, children in care or children with additional needs.

We want every child to have the best possible start in life. It’s why we’re so passionate about getting children reading.

Our work is funded by Arts Council England, as well as BookTrust’s partners and donors.
